1. Assets and investments liable to CGT
If you own assets such as shares, property or a business, you can be liable to CGT when you sell them or give them away if they have increased in value since you acquired them.
2. What is not liable?
Some assets are free of CGT. The main ones are: your principal residence, private motor cars, personal possessions disposed of for less than £6,000 or with a useful life of 50 years or less, investments held in Peps, Isas, Tessas, National Savings & Investments products; British government stock and most corporate bonds.
Also exempt are shares held in a venture capital trust or enterprise investment scheme, proceeds of pension plans and life insurance policies, unless purchased second-hand.
3. Gifts to your spouse
Gifts between husband and wife are not liable to CGT provided that you are living together at the time or it is within the year of separation. But tax will be payable when your spouse sells or gives away the asset. The gain will then be calculated as if your spouse had owned the asset from the time you acquired it. So transferring assets to a spouse who is a lower-rate taxpayer can reduce the eventual bill.
4. When you die
There will be no CGT to pay on any assets that you leave when you die, but there may be an inheritance tax liability if the assets exceed the nil-rate band (currently £263,000).
5. The annual allowance
You will not have to pay tax if your total capital gains in a tax year are less than your annual CGT allowance (£8,200 for the current tax year). So married couples together can receive up to £16,400 of gains tax-free. Transferring assets between spouses before a disposal can ensure that husband and wife fully use their exemptions.
Children have an annual allowance of £8,200 on their investments, which may be held in a “bare trust” on their behalf. But when parents make gifts of assets to children, other than cash, this will be considered a disposal.
